SECOND A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AND SECURITY AGREEMENT
     This Second Amendment to Credit and Security Agreement (“Amendment”) is made as of this 6th day of November, 2007, by and among OREXIGEN THERAPEUTICS, INC., a Delaware corporation (the “Borrower”), those financial institutions listed on the signature pages hereto as the “Lenders” party to the Credit Agreement referenced below and MERRILL LYNCH CAPITAL, a division of Merrill Lynch Business Financial Services Inc., as “Administrative Agent” under the Credit Agreement referenced below.
BACKGROUND
     A. Borrower, Lenders and Administrative Agent are party to that certain Credit and Security Agreement dated as of December 15, 2006 (as it may heretofore have been and may hereafter be amended, modified, extended, supplemented, restated or replaced, the “Credit Agreement”) among Borrower and any other persons from time to time party thereto as a “Borrower”, Lenders and any other financial institutions or other entities from time to time party thereto as “Lenders” and Administrative Agent. All capitalized terms used herein and not defined herein shall have the meaning ascribed to such term in the Credit Agreement. Pursuant to the Credit Agreement, Lenders extended a certain Term Loan to Borrowers as more particularly described therein. The Credit Agreement, all Financing Documents and all instruments, documents, and agreements related thereto or executed in connection therewith, together with all amendments, restatements, modifications, extensions, consolidations and substitutions, are sometimes referred to herein collectively as the “Existing Loan Documents.”
     B. Borrower has requested that Lenders agree to certain modifications and amendments to the provisions of the Credit Agreement, including among other things an increase in the total amount available for advances under the Term Loan, and Lenders have agreed to grant such requests on and subject to the conditions and terms provided for in this Amendment.
     NOW THEREFORE, with the foregoing Background deemed incorporated by reference in this Amendment and for good and valuable consideration, the receipt and sufficiency of which are hereby acknowledged, the parties hereto, intending to be legally bound, covenant and agree as follows:
     1. AMENDMENTS.
          (a) Term Loan Increase. As of the date hereof, immediately prior to giving effect to this Amendment, Borrower has requested and received advance(s) under the Term Loan totaling $10,000,000 and the total amount available for additional advances under the Term Loan pursuant to the Term Loan Commitment of $17,000,000 hereof is $7,000,0000. Upon the effectiveness of this Amendment, Administrative Agent and Lenders shall reset the Term Loan by making available to Borrower additional availability for advances under the Term Loan in the principal amount of $8,000,000 (the “Term Loan Increase”) and thereby increasing the total Term Loan Commitment from $17,000,000 to $25,000,000 and increasing the total amount available for additional advances under the Term Loan from $7,000,000 to $15,000,000 (the “Unfunded Term Loan Balance”). The outstanding principal balance of the Term Loan as of the date hereof is $8,055,555.54 (“Existing Funded Term Loan”). Subject to the terms and conditions of the Credit Agreement, Borrower may request that advances under the Term Loan be made to Borrower in respect of the Unfunded Term Loan Balance only as follows: (i) Borrower shall be obligated to request an advance of $8,000,000 of the Unfunded Term Loan Balance to be made on or before December 31, 2007 (“First Tranche”) and (ii) Borrower may request an advance of $7,000,000 (subject to reduction in accordance with the following proviso) to be made at any time concurrently with or after the making of the First Tranche but not later than December 31, 2008 (the “Second Tranche”); provided that the total amount available to Borrower to be borrowed under the Second Tranche (and the corresponding amounts of the Term Loan Commitment and the Unfunded Term Loan Balance) shall be reduced by $6,481.48 per day commencing on July 1, 2008. Notwithstanding anything to the contrary contained in Credit Agreement, no advances under the Term Loan shall be made after December 31, 2008, and any portion of the Term Loan Commitment not funded as of the close of

 


 

business on December 31, 2008 shall thereupon automatically be terminated and the Term Loan Commitment Amount of each Lender as of such date shall be reduced by such Lender’s Pro Rata Share of such total reduction in the Term Loan Commitment. Without limiting the generality of anything contained in Section 2.1(a)(i) of the Credit Agreement, each Lender’s obligation to fund the First Tranche and the Second Tranche shall be limited to such Lender’s Term Loan Commitment Percentage of each such advance, and no Lender shall have any obligation to fund any portion of either the First Tranche or the Second Tranche required to be funded by any other Lender, but not so funded.

(d) Exit Fee. Section 2.2(f) of the Credit Agreement is hereby amended and restated in its entirety as follows:
(f) Exit Fee. Upon repayment of the Term Loan in full for any reason and at any time (whether by voluntary prepayment by Borrowers, by reason of the occurrence of an Event of Default, upon the maturity of the Term Loan, or otherwise), Borrowers shall pay to Administrative Agent for the benefit of all Lenders committed to make Term Loan advances, as compensation for the costs of making funds available to Borrowers under this Agreement, an exit fee (the “Exit Fee”) calculated in accordance with this subsection. The total Exit Fee due under this Agreement shall be equal to the greater of (x) an amount equal to (1) the total aggregate original principal amount of all advances under the Term Loan requested by Borrowers and funded by Lenders under Section 2.1(a) above multiplied by (2) five percent (5.00%) or (y) $900,000. All fees payable pursuant to this paragraph shall be deemed fully earned and non-refundable as of the Closing Date. Notwithstanding anything to the contrary provided for in the foregoing or otherwise in this Agreement, in the event that Borrowers shall fail to request an advance under the Term Loan in the amount of $8,000,000 representing the First Tranche (as defined in the Second Amendment) on or before 2:00 PM (Chicago time) on December 27, 2007, then for purposes of calculating the total Exit Fee due under this Agreement pursuant to this Section 2.2(f), Borrowers shall be deemed to have requested such an advance under the Term Loan in such amount be made on December 31, 2007 and then to have immediately repaid such advance on such December 31, 2007.
(e) Prepayment Fee. Section 2.2(g) of the Credit Agreement is hereby amended by adding the following new sentence to the end thereof:
Notwithstanding anything to the contrary provided for in the foregoing or otherwise in this Agreement, in the event that Borrowers shall fail to request an advance under the Term Loan in the amount of $8,000,000 representing the First Tranche (as defined in the Second Amendment) on or before 2:00 PM (Chicago time) on December 27, 2007, then for purposes of this Section 2.2(g), Borrowers shall be deemed to have requested and received such an advance under the Term Loan in such amount on December 31, 2007 and then to have immediately repaid such advance on such December 31, 2007, and in such case, a Prepayment Fee in the amount of $240,000 shall become automatically due and payable, and be fully earned and non-refundable, on and as of December 31, 2007.
